Misc. Info and Procedures Misc. Info and Procedures

The following are the procedures for Room 9

Class begins @ 9:00 (Students should be prepared and sitting in their seats at this time
.)

Lunch: Lunch times are 12:05 and 12:10
.  

Snack Break

: Students are allowed to bring in a  healthy snack each day. Sugary treats will be saved for lunch.

Parties

: We have two parties: Halloween and Valentine's Day. Our room parents will be contacting you to request donations of time or food throughout the year.

Birthday Treats

: Students may bring in treats to share  to celebrate their birthday. If your child's birthday is in the summer, they may pick any day to celebrate.

Assignments Chart

: Students should record all assignments, test dates, project dates, and special activities every day on their assignment chart. In addition to the chart, homework is available by email and posted to this site. Please initial the chart daily.

Homework Policy

: If students forget to bring their homework to school, they will be "charged" Behavior Bucks and/or "party points" will be taken away. 


Evaluations

: There are four report cards sent home during the year. Midway through each grading period, interims reports are issued as necessary. Conferences are scheduled during November and  as needed. Please feel free to contact me at st_rmiller@smfcsd.org  if you would like to meet at any time during the year.



Dismissal Procedures: If  your child plans to go home a way other than customary, please send in a note to the office that morning.  Dismissal begins at 3:30.
